Medical Advisor
EPM Scientific is partnering with a leading pharmaceutical company expanding its Medical Affairs function in Germany. This is a unique opportunity to shape medical strategy and drive scientific excellence in a dynamic, cross-functional environment.
Location: Germany (Remote/Hybrid options available)
Start Date: July/August 2025 (Flexible)
Contract Type: Permanent
Languages Required: Fluent in German and English
Therapeutic Area: Aesthetic Medicine
Key Responsibilities
- Develop and execute medical strategies across the product lifecycle-from early development to post-launch.
- Ensure alignment with global brand objectives and uphold scientific integrity.
- Work closely with Marketing, Clinical Development, Regulatory Affairs, Patient Engagement, RWE, Legal, and Digital teams.
- Integrate medical insights into strategic and operational planning.
- Craft the medical narrative to guide evidence generation and communication.
- Support publication planning, data dissemination, and scientific content development.
- Clinical Research Oversight
- Provide input and oversight for Phase IV trials, Investigator-Initiated Studies (IIS), and Early Access Programs (EAPs).
- Organize and lead advisory boards, expert panels, and roundtables.
- Represent the company at scientific congresses and patient engagement events.
- Conduct medical landscape assessments, scenario planning, and competitive simulations to inform strategy.
- Contribute to pharmacoeconomic value propositions and early access strategies for patients with unmet needs.
- Support German medical teams in aligning with global strategies, including resource planning and launch readiness.
- Collaborate with Key External Experts (KEEs) to gather insights that inform clinical development and brand strategy.
Candidate Profile
- Proven experience in Medical Affairs within the pharmaceutical industry (Germany or EU).
- Strong understanding of drug development, regulatory frameworks, and market access in Germany.
- Expertise in clinical study design, data interpretation, and evidence generation.
- Excellent communication and stakeholder management skills.
- Ability to manage cross-functional projects independently.
- Experience in competitive intelligence and strategic planning is a plus.
